Output 53a0ece80da2e1ac0ca17e8bee02e06963d29f434d5306be5f2a7a5ef418144c:39

value
40782878
script pubkey
OP_0 OP_PUSHBYTES_20 90184d2f36e7c54b0492b1de3add27ec1b9e3691
address
ltc1qjqvy6tekulz5kpyjk80r4hf8asdeud53qzq9c7
transaction
53a0ece80da2e1ac0ca17e8bee02e06963d29f434d5306be5f2a7a5ef418144c
spent
true